Li Auto opens first overseas R&D center in Munich to develop EV tech and expand globally.

Li Auto, a Chinese electric vehicle maker, has opened its first overseas R&D center in Munich, Germany. The center will focus on developing next-generation technologies like vehicle design, power semiconductors, and electric drivetrains, while also adapting to European market needs and regulations. This move aims to enhance global expansion and collaboration in the electric vehicle sector.
